前言
这是一篇前端离职项目交接清单(front-end handover checklist)。
仰天大笑出门去,我辈岂是蓬蒿人? 金三银四就要到了,大家一定跃跃欲试,甚至已经收获了很多offer。
即将入职公司:同学请问下周可以入职吗?
当前领导 or HR: 同学申请离职需要提前一个月申请,交接结束后才可以同意离职!
本文这边准备如下前端项目离职交接清单,如果我们找到了新的工作需要准备哪些东西可以完美交接并快速离职~
为什么要准备交接清单?
假设你离职已然成为事实,领导和HR很少会特别去卡时间,其实更多的是希望新的人员可以完美接受你现有的工作,所以我们要准备好交接清单,让接手人员熟悉项目,快速成为曾经的你尤为重要。
当我们找到了新的工作,无论如何我们一定在当前公司学到了很多东西,即使有负面的情绪,我们也要感谢现有的平台,提高了我们抗压能力,就算离开我们也要于赞扬中转身。
交接清单(描述版)
辅助文档方面
-
项目代码地址;
用途: 代码地址这个肯定是必需的,巧妇难为无米之炊;
-
项目接口文档地址;
用途: 代码请求的后端接口地址,用于后续改参数,更换接口之类的需求;
-
项目UI设计稿/原型地址/项目历史需求列表文档;
用途: 这个必不可少,用于新需求的确认以及问题的及时排查;
-
项目现有问题/待优化问题;
用途: 可以帮助接手人员快速明白当前项目存在问题,可能存在的坑和漏洞;
-
目前是否有需要迭代的功能;
用途: 接手人员可以确认跟进当前未完成的需求。
-
项目功能及作用;
用途: 知其然才能知其所以然,我们辛辛苦苦的写的东西,一定得把它的功能、优势等等等等描述的栩栩如生。
-
当前项目可能关联人员;
用途: 让接手人员出现问题,可以及时寻找对应人员,不必再来与我们多次交接。
代码方面
-
项目代码目前技术栈、使用框架版本;
用途: 需要确认清楚代码使用的框架及使用的版本,版本不同之间的差异也很大,防止接手人员踩坑;
-
项目结构的整理文档;
用途: 我们可以尽量把目录用途,配置描述,充分叙述清楚,离开也要体面潇洒的离开。
示例:
-
代码重要模块功能概述;
用途: 重要模块肯定流着我们无数的汗水,我们必须得把他的精华仔仔细细、认认真真的告诉别人,事了拂衣去,深藏身与名!
-
项目中有是否依赖其他项目功能,如有需叙述下相关使用的逻辑;
用途: 这个也是防止接手同事踩坑的好东西,当我们项目或者依赖引用了其他的项目的功能or接口之类的,万一依赖的项目出现问题,接手人员无法及时排查出问题。
-
项目代码版本、分支、提交规范及策略;
用途: 项目版本如何管理,不同分支的作用、commit提交是否有固定格式,这个也需要标注清楚,以防止接手人员在你睡觉的时候打电话给你,告诉你哪哪哪哪有报错,需要你的协助。
-
项目代码构建打包方式、发布流程;
用途: 让接手人员了解项目开发完成之后,如何构建打包?如何发布到test、uat、pro等环境;
交接清单(清新版)
辅助文档方面
-
项目代码地址;
-
项目接口文档地址;
-
项目UI设计稿/原型地址/项目历史需求列表文档;
-
项目历史需求列表文档;
-
项目现有问题/待优化问题;
-
目前是否有需要迭代的功能;
-
项目功能及作用;
-
当前项目可能关联人员
代码方面
- 项目代码目前技术栈、使用框架版本;
- 项目结构的整理文档;
- 代码重要模块功能概述;
- 项目代码版本、分支、提交规范及策略;
- 项目代码构建打包方式、发布的流程;
- 项目中有是否依赖其他项目功能,如有请叙述下相关使用的逻辑;
后序
我等采石之人,当心怀大教堂之愿景,在一个项目的总体结构之内,总有空间展示个性和匠心,,我们需要尽可能的把它描述的更加细致。
百年之后,我们的代码或许如今日的土建工程师看待中世纪大教堂建造者使用的技法一样陈旧,但是我们的匠心一定会得到尊重。
欢迎补充完善:点击这里提交PR